Output 64acf5bef4cc16beceecdcbe3fc2f4bb6fda2e958a6718b67fcf26b6ae57444c:78

value
854918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ccc46815ea559af450a7fda4e5efeea1e5c2e65c OP_EQUAL
address
3LMj4FDQbNBupBk5w8qa3wYTiPWtP3UVPe
transaction
64acf5bef4cc16beceecdcbe3fc2f4bb6fda2e958a6718b67fcf26b6ae57444c
confirmations
244358
spent
true